2024 NSMQ Regional Contests Dates and Pairings out

2024 NSMQ Regional Contests

Primetime, the organisers of the coveted National Science and Math Quiz, have announced the 2024 NSMQ regional contest dates along with the pairings. The regional championships start from June 10th to June 19th, 2024.

All in all, over 150 schools will be competing for a lot at the national level.

Bono East NSMQ 2024 Regional Contests

On Wednesday, June 12, 2024, four regional contests will be organised for SHSs in the Bono East region to help determine representatives for the region at the national contest. 

Ahafo NSMQ 2024 Regional Contests

Tuesday, June 11, 2024, will be the turn of schools in the Ahafo region. In all, there will be four contests for the schools in the NSMQ 2024 Regional Contests.
